Output e08a41538d93f0d413157df0cda365ec0f3c1aa7d993c22aac5bfe20bc1c2e4d:0

value
2390848
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51c22a2817df58cb191c198cde99711dd7c8976b OP_EQUAL
address
MFMTZmQrti9pBjnJn6QNKTuxjyxoXiZUoa
transaction
e08a41538d93f0d413157df0cda365ec0f3c1aa7d993c22aac5bfe20bc1c2e4d
spent
true